British Sovereign Gold Coins

The British Sovereign gold coins, also known as “coin of the realm” is a popular collection piece for many coin collectors.

According to experts, the British Sovereign gold coins are one of the longest running series of nationally minted coins that are made of gold (since 1489).

Characteristically, the British Sovereign gold coins are composed of .2354 ounces of gold. They are about the size of the U.S. nickel.

The British Sovereign gold coins always feature the portrait of the reigning king or queen like George III, George IV, William IV, Victoria, Edward VII, George V, George VI and Elizabeth II.  According to most expert collectors and numismatists, collecting the coins by monarchy is the way to do

The British Sovereign gold coins often sell at a premium value. Older British Sovereign gold coins carry a significant premium because of its rarity and collectability.

Even if the British Sovereign gold coins are widely accepted, finding them at a fair market price can be difficult.

The easiest way to acquire British Sovereign gold coins is to buy directly from the British Royal Mint. Or, you can also purchase from silver and gold coin brokers online.
